Hello, How hard is it to change pushrod tubes? What exactly is involved in replacing them? It a head off job? will i need new head bolts etc? Cheers Alex
Engine out, heads off Im afraid, no new head bolts needed, just seals and tubes if they are too corroded/damaged to stretch and re-use.
i use jaycee pushrod tubes no probs no leaks , easy to do with heads on , but there are crap ones out there , empi, GSf , i even threw a set of cb ones away
Managed to do mine with engine in was a bit of a fiddle and if i was to do it again i would take the engine out. As others have said make sure you get the good seals i put a bit of wellseal on the seals as well and not had a leak from them for 2years
